Web16 jan. 2024 · MCV is a measurement of the average size of your red blood cells. MCH results tend to mirror MCV results. This is because bigger red blood cells generally … WebWhen your RDW is normal, but the MCV is low, then it can be a sign of anaemia as a result of thalassemia or a chronic condition. If your RDW is normal, but the MCV is high, then it can be a sign of a liver condition or alcohol abuse. You can even receive this result if you’re on chemotherapy or antiviral drugs.
